YouTuber Derek from his channel More Plates More Dates (MPMD), Uploaded a video to his official channel, titled—— liver king lie. As of this writing, the hour-long video has racked up 1.2 million views in 24 hours.
In the video, the content creator claims to have found important evidence that the Liver King, whose real name is Brian Johnson, is not as natural as he claims.
More Plates More Dates Reveal Liver King Takes Steroids To Achieve Bodybuilding Physique
In the video, the YouTuber shared an email exchange between Johnson and a bodybuilding trainer. In the email, the duped social media star admitted to taking $12,000 a month in HGH medication, which included three injections a day. Some of the substances he consumed included IGF, CJC, Decca, Omnitrope, Winstrol, and Test Cyp.
In the video, Derek also revealed that Johnson contacted him in May 2021 to try to sell him coaching comfort. The latter said he was experimenting with different peptides.
In June of that year, the YouTuber received an email from an alleged colleague of Johnson asking for his advice on the HGH prescription Johnson was taking.
Meanwhile, Johnson took to social media to tout his holistic approach to spending raw meat He claims the way our ancestors used to do. He also marketed products and supplements to his followers under the guise of a natural lifestyle, claiming that they helped him build an impressive muscular frame.
